Comprehending SMILE Eye Surgery



When thinking about SMILE Eye Surgery, it is essential to understand the treatment and its advantages. SMILE, which means Little Cut Lenticule Extraction, is a minimally invasive laser eye surgical procedure that remedies usual vision problems like nearsightedness (nearsightedness).

Throughout the treatment, your eye surgeon will certainly use a femtosecond laser to develop a little cut in your cornea. Through this cut, a little disc of tissue called a lenticule is removed, improving the cornea and correcting your vision.

Among the vital advantages of SMILE Eye Surgical procedure is its quick recovery time. Many patients experience enhanced vision within a day or 2 after the procedure, with minimal discomfort.

Additionally, SMILE is recognized for its high success price in providing lasting vision correction. Unlike find more , SMILE does not need the production of a flap in the cornea, lowering the danger of complications and allowing for a much more steady corneal framework post-surgery.

Comprehending the procedure and its advantages is essential when thinking about SMILE Eye Surgical treatment for vision modification.

Identifying Qualification for SMILE



To identify if you're eligible for SMILE eye surgery, your ophthalmologist will carry out a thorough analysis of your eye wellness and vision needs. Throughout this evaluation, factors such as the stability of your vision prescription, the density of your cornea, and the overall health of your eyes will certainly be examined.

Usually, prospects for SMILE more than 22 years of ages, have a steady vision prescription for a minimum of a year, and have healthy and balanced corneas without problems like keratoconus.


Your optometrist will certainly additionally consider your total eye health and wellness, any type of existing eye conditions, and your way of living needs to determine if SMILE is the appropriate selection for you. It's essential to connect any details aesthetic needs or issues you might have throughout this assessment to ensure that the therapy lines up with your assumptions.

If you aren't eligible for SMILE, your ophthalmologist might recommend different vision modification choices that far better suit your individual needs and eye wellness condition.
